当前位置: 首页 > 专利查询>胡超专利>正文

一种跑步锻炼系统技术方案

技术编号:15921660 阅读:26 留言:0更新日期:2017-08-04 01:52
本发明专利技术公开了一种跑步锻炼系统,包括:路线编制模块,耦接于外部地图服务系统;路线存储模块,耦接于路线编制模块;打卡点生成模块,耦接于路线存储模块和数据库;跑步监控终端,设置在系统用户手机中,与数据库通信连接,该跑步监控终端内具有跑步监测模块和成绩生成模块。本发明专利技术的跑步锻炼系统,通过路线编制模块和路线存储模块的设置,可以有效的制定出跑步路线,而通过打卡点生成模块、数据库和跑步终端的设置,可以有效的实现监督系统用户按照路线跑步锻炼的效果。

Running exercise system

The invention discloses a running system, including route establishment module, coupled to the external map service system; route storage module is coupled to the route establishment module; punch point generation module is coupled to the memory module and the database running route; monitoring terminal, set up in the system of mobile phone users in connection with database communication the monitoring terminal is running, running monitoring module and result generation module. Running the system of the invention, the route scheduling module and route storage module settings, can effectively develop running routes, and through the punch point generation module, database and running terminal settings, can realize the supervision system of the user in accordance with the route running effectively.

【技术实现步骤摘要】

本专利技术涉及一种锻炼系统,更具体的说是涉及一种跑步锻炼系统
技术介绍
随着我国用户身体素质的连年下降,用户体质健康问题备受国家和社会的关注。虽然随着《国家用户体质健康标准》(以下简称《标准》)的全面实施和阳光体育运动的开展,我国的用户体质健康工作取得了一定的成绩。但在实施过程中,体质健康监控管理部门因为众多因素难以对用户的日常锻炼进行有效的监控,体质健康监控普遍存在重测试而轻干预,重测试数据上报而疏于反馈等现象。我国用户的体质光靠有限的校内体育课是较难得到显著的提升的,因此需要用户在课余时间进行进一步的身体锻炼,从而实现我国用户身体素质的可持续性进步。跑步运动其因受到的设施、人员、环境、经济等意思制约较小,所以是目前我国开展最为广泛和普及的运动项目,也是发展身体素质最为全面的项目,其通过对距离和速度的控制,可以有效的发展锻炼者的力量、耐力及心肺功能。但是跑步运动本身也属于一种较为枯燥的运动,其在养成跑步运动行为习惯前,容易因为各方面的原因致使其运动行为习惯养成的失败。我国目前因师资资源的有限,难以实现以校方督促用户养成跑步运动行为习惯的目标,因此基于互联网的督促用户跑步运动软件系统,成为了现阶段可实现大规模监控及督促用户养成跑步运动行为习惯的一个可行性方案。
技术实现思路
本专利技术的目的在于提供一种可实现大规模监控及督促用户养成跑步运动行为习惯的系统。为实现上述目的,本专利技术提供了如下技术方案:一种跑步锻炼系统,包括:路线编制模块,耦接于外部地图服务系统,获取外部地图服务系统内的地图信息,用于在地图信息建立跑步路线,形成路线数据,该跑步路线具有起点和终点;路线存储模块,耦接于路线编制模块,用于存储路线编制模块编制获得路线数据;打卡点生成模块,耦接于路线存储模块,用于调用路线存储模块内的路线数据,并依据该路线数据生成跑步路线起点打卡点和终点打卡点;数据库,用于存储用户身份信息和成绩信息,其中身份信息包括用户ID号、身份证号和姓名,用户ID号根据身份证号和姓名自动生成,其内具有作弊账号组,用于存放认定为作弊的用户账号;用户终端,设置在用户手上,与数据库通信连接,识别并传输用户身份信息和成绩信息至数据库形成用户账号,还与路线存储模块通信,用于接收路线存储模块随机输出的路线,该用户终端内具有运动监测模块和成绩生成模块,所述运动监测模块与成绩生成模块之间相互通信,其中,运动监测模块用于对起点打卡点和终点打卡点进行打卡并输出打卡信息以及输出运动位置信息,成绩生成模块接收打卡信息和运动位置信息生成成绩信息;反作弊模块,耦接于用户终端内的运动监测模块,还耦接于数据库,用于接收运动监测模块所输出的打卡信息,并记录第一个打卡点的打卡时间,当记录到多个用户终端所对应的用户账号在同一时间所打卡的第一个打卡点相同的次数超过三次,将多个用户终端的用户账号输入到数据库的作弊账号组的某一序列组内作为作弊账号;并还与路线存储模块通信,路线存储模块发送预先选定的路线至用户账户对应的用户终端,运动监测模块实时监测用户是否按照选定的路线运动,其中,当作弊账号组内的账号连续三次不在同一时间第一打卡点相同时,将该作弊账号组内账号从数据库内的作弊账号组清除。作为本专利技术的进一步改进,所述打卡点生成模块包括:二维码/条形码编码模块,耦接于路线存储模块,用于调用路线存储模块内的路线数据,并依据路线数据生成起、终点二维码/条形码图形;二维码/条形码打印模块,耦接于二维码/条形码编码模块,用于接收二维码/条形码编码模块生成的起、终点二维码/条形码图形,并将该二维码/条形码图形进行打印成形生成起点打卡点和终点打卡点,其中,起点打卡点和终点打卡点用于设置在地图信息内跑步路线的起、终点实地位置上;或者是,所述打卡点生成模块包括:距离监测模块,该距离监测模块内具有距离阈值,所述距离监测模块耦接与用户终端,用于接收用户终端输出的用户运动位置信息,还耦接于路线存储模块,用于调用路线存储模块内的路线数据,并将路线的起点和终点加上距离阈值作为打卡点。作为本专利技术的进一步改进,所述二维码/条形码编码模块与二维码/条形码打印模块之间耦接有二维码/条形码显示模块,该二维码/条形码显示模块用于显示二维码/条形码编码模块输出的起、终点二维码/条形码图形。作为本专利技术的进一步改进,所述用户终端为搭载有微信的智能手机,所述运动检测模块包括微信公众号端打点模块和GPS定位模块,所述微信公众号端打点模块与智能手机摄像机通信,并与反作弊模块通信连接,用于扫描起、终点二维码/条形码图形,所述GPS定位模块用于定时发出GPS位置信号,所述成绩生成模块为微信公众号端成绩模块,其中,微信公众号端打点模块计算起点打卡点与终点打卡点之间的打卡时间,微信公众号端成绩模块接收打卡时间和GPS位置信号,并依据打卡时间和GPS位置信号计算出成绩。作为本专利技术的进一步改进,所述路线编制模块编制路线的步骤如下:步骤一、通过外部地图服务系统获取当前城市的卫星定位地图,并通过页面显示出来;步骤二、在获取到的卫星定位地图上点击不同的位置获取不同点位的经纬度坐标,同时在定位地图显示页面上呈现出每个点之间的距离,以第一点的点位为起点,以最后一点的点位为终点,采用不同颜色及文字加以标注在页面上;步骤三、输入线路名称和距离,同时判断点击的点是否是继承于之前其他创建的点,若是继承于之前其他创建的点,提供进行对之前点位的选择;步骤四、页面上显示起、终点及中间预设多个点位的连线,形成一条跑步路线,在显示路线后判断线路数据是否建立,若点击页面按钮“是”则保存线路数据,若点击页面按钮“否”,则对当前页面创建的点进行一次性全部清除,以备重新选择路线点,若未被点击则不进行任何动作;步骤五、将步骤四所保存的线路数据传输到路线存储模块进行存储。作为本专利技术的进一步改进,所述路线存储模块耦接有线路管理模块,所述线路管理模块用于修改路线存储模块内的跑步线路信息的查看、修改和删除。作为本专利技术的进一步改进,所述线路管理模块内具有列表显示模块,所述列表显示模块显示线路名称、首要端点坐标、次要端点坐标、创建时间、线路距离和操作界面,该线路管理模块内还具有操作模块,所述操作模块包括提交新距离按钮、线路详情按钮和删除按钮,其中,当点下提交新距离按钮时,修改保存线路的长度,当点下线路详情按钮时,与外部地图服务系统通信,显示线路地图,当点下删除按钮时,删除当前操作的跑步线路。作为本专利技术的进一步改进,用户使用所述用户终端进行跑步锻炼的步骤如下:五一、用户登陆智能手机上的微信并关注微信公众号,并在微信公众号上登陆;五二、判断是否为第一次登陆,若是第一次登陆,则需输入学号和身份证号进行判定,之后将输入的学号和身份证号与数据库内存储的用户信息内的学号和身份证号进行匹配;若匹配成功则从用户微型中获取OPENID与数据库内存储的用户信息内的ID号进行绑定,继续下面步骤,若匹配失败则提示输入错误,返回输入步骤,若不是第一次登陆则继续下面步骤;五三、在登陆完成以后进入锻炼页面,页面显示当前运动总耗时、所有运动的平均配速、开始运动按钮和历史运动记录,若未点击开始运动按钮,则不进行任何动作,若点击开始运动按钮则弹出菜单,其中,菜单内容包括运动条款按钮和正式开本文档来自技高网...
一种跑步锻炼系统

【技术保护点】
一种跑步锻炼系统,其特征在于,包括:路线编制模块(1),耦接于外部地图服务系统,获取外部地图服务系统内的地图信息,用于在地图信息建立跑步路线,形成路线数据,该跑步路线具有起点和终点;路线存储模块(2),耦接于路线编制模块(1),用于存储路线编制模块(1)编制获得路线数据;打卡点生成模块(3),耦接于路线存储模块(2),用于调用路线存储模块(2)内的路线数据,并依据该路线数据生成跑步路线起点打卡点和终点打卡点;数据库(4),用于存储用户身份信息和成绩信息,其中身份信息包括用户ID号、身份证号和姓名,用户ID号根据身份证号和姓名自动生成,其内具有作弊账号组,用于存放认定为作弊的用户账号;用户终端(5),设置在用户手上,与数据库(4)通信连接,识别并传输用户身份信息和成绩信息至数据库(4)形成用户账号,还与路线存储模块(2)通信,用于接收路线存储模块(2)随机输出的路线,该用户终端(5)内具有运动监测模块(51)和成绩生成模块(52),所述运动监测模块(51)与成绩生成模块(52)之间相互通信,其中,运动监测模块(51)用于对起点打卡点和终点打卡点进行打卡并输出打卡信息以及输出运动位置信息,成绩生成模块(52)接收打卡信息和运动位置信息生成成绩信息;反作弊模块,耦接于用户终端(5)内的运动监测模块(51),还耦接于数据库(4),用于接收运动监测模块(51)所输出的打卡信息,并记录第一个打卡点的打卡时间,当记录到多个用户终端(5)所对应的用户账号在同一时间所打卡的第一个打卡点相同的次数超过三次,将多个用户终端(5)的用户账号输入到数据库(4)的作弊账号组的某一序列组内作为作弊账号;并还与路线存储模块(2)通信,路线存储模块(2)发送预先选定的路线至用户账户对应的用户终端(5),运动监测模块(51)实时监测用户是否按照选定的路线运动,其中,当作弊账号组内的账号连续三次不在同一时间第一打卡点相同时,将该作弊账号组内账号从数据库(4)内的作弊账号组清除。...

【技术特征摘要】
1.一种跑步锻炼系统,其特征在于,包括:路线编制模块(1),耦接于外部地图服务系统,获取外部地图服务系统内的地图信息,用于在地图信息建立跑步路线,形成路线数据,该跑步路线具有起点和终点;路线存储模块(2),耦接于路线编制模块(1),用于存储路线编制模块(1)编制获得路线数据;打卡点生成模块(3),耦接于路线存储模块(2),用于调用路线存储模块(2)内的路线数据,并依据该路线数据生成跑步路线起点打卡点和终点打卡点;数据库(4),用于存储用户身份信息和成绩信息,其中身份信息包括用户ID号、身份证号和姓名,用户ID号根据身份证号和姓名自动生成,其内具有作弊账号组,用于存放认定为作弊的用户账号;用户终端(5),设置在用户手上,与数据库(4)通信连接,识别并传输用户身份信息和成绩信息至数据库(4)形成用户账号,还与路线存储模块(2)通信,用于接收路线存储模块(2)随机输出的路线,该用户终端(5)内具有运动监测模块(51)和成绩生成模块(52),所述运动监测模块(51)与成绩生成模块(52)之间相互通信,其中,运动监测模块(51)用于对起点打卡点和终点打卡点进行打卡并输出打卡信息以及输出运动位置信息,成绩生成模块(52)接收打卡信息和运动位置信息生成成绩信息;反作弊模块,耦接于用户终端(5)内的运动监测模块(51),还耦接于数据库(4),用于接收运动监测模块(51)所输出的打卡信息,并记录第一个打卡点的打卡时间,当记录到多个用户终端(5)所对应的用户账号在同一时间所打卡的第一个打卡点相同的次数超过三次,将多个用户终端(5)的用户账号输入到数据库(4)的作弊账号组的某一序列组内作为作弊账号;并还与路线存储模块(2)通信,路线存储模块(2)发送预先选定的路线至用户账户对应的用户终端(5),运动监测模块(51)实时监测用户是否按照选定的路线运动,其中,当作弊账号组内的账号连续三次不在同一时间第一打卡点相同时,将该作弊账号组内账号从数据库(4)内的作弊账号组清除。2.根据权利要求1所述的跑步锻炼系统,其特征在于:所述打卡点生成模块(3)包括:二维码/条形码编码模块(31),耦接于路线存储模块(2),用于调用路线存储模块(2)内的路线数据,并依据路线数据生成起、终点二维码/条形码图形;二维码/条形码打印模块(32),耦接于二维码/条形码编码模块(31),用于接收二维码/条形码编码模块(31)生成的起、终点二维码/条形码图形,并将该二维码/条形码图形进行打印成形生成起点打卡点和终点打卡点,其中,起点打卡点和终点打卡点用于设置在地图信息内跑步路线的起、终点实地位置上;或者是,所述打卡点生成模块(3)包括:距离监测模块,该距离监测模块内具有距离阈值,所述距离监测模块耦接与用户终端(5),用于接收用户终端(5)输出的用户运动位置信息,还耦接于路线存储模块(2),用于调用路线存储模块(2)内的路线数据,并将路线的起点和终点加上距离阈值作为打卡点。3.根据权利要求2所述的跑步锻炼系统,其特征在于:所述二维码/条形码编码模块(31)与二维码/条形码打印模块(32)之间耦接有二维码/条形码显示模块(33),该二维码/条形码显示模块(33)用于显示二维码/条形码编码模块(31)输出的起、终点二维码/条形码图形。4.根据权利要求2或3所述的跑步锻炼系统,其特征在于:所述用户终端为(5)搭载有微信的智能手机,所述运动检测模块(51)包括微信公众号端打点模块(511)和GPS定位模块(512),所述微信公众号端打点模块(511)与智能手机摄像机通信,并与反作弊模块通信连接,用于扫描起、终点二维码/条形码图形,所述GPS定位模块(512)用于定时发出GPS位置信号,所述成绩生成模块(52)为微信公众号端成绩模块,其中,微信公众号端打点模块(511)计算起点打卡点与终点打卡点之间的打卡时间,微信公众号端成绩模块接收打卡时间和GPS位置信号,并依据打卡时间和GPS位置信号计算出成绩。5.根据权利要求1或2或3所述的跑步锻炼系统,其特征在于:所述路线编制模块(1)编制路线的步骤如下:步骤一、通过外部地图服务系统获取当前城市的卫星定位地图,并通过页面显示出来;步骤二、在获取到的卫星定位地图上点击不同的位置获取不同点位的经纬度坐标,同时在定位地图显示页面上呈现出每个点之间的距离,以第一点的点位为起点,以最后一点的点位为终点,采用不同颜色及文字加以标注在页面上;步骤三、输入线路名称和距离,同时判断点击的点是否是继承于之前其他创建的点,若是继承于之前其他创建的点,提供进行对之前点位的选择;步骤四、页面上显示起、终点及中间预设多个点位的连线,形成一条跑步路线,同时将多个点位作为该条线路的沿途验证经、纬度点位,在显示路线后判断线路数据是否建立,若点击页面按钮...

【专利技术属性】
技术研发人员:胡超
申请(专利权)人:胡超
类型:发明
国别省市:浙江;33

网友询问留言 已有0条评论
  • 还没有人留言评论。发表了对其他浏览者有用的留言会获得科技券。

1